Thank god finally someone with the same problem, I've trawled the internet and you're the only other one I found! I'm in the UK on the carrier EE. My signal literally disappears and almost refreshes. Was every 5 minutes or so when I received the phone now it's ever 30 seconds. If you open the settings screen - the 'Carrier' option disappears for me whenever it drops out. Then if you try and make a call whilst it's dropped it says there is no SIM Card. And for the record I live in a 5 bar signal area (the antenna is on the building next door in fact).
I reset network settings, restored the phone, tried sim in old iPhone 5 (running ios8 so not a software issues), there was no problem. Tried a different SIM in my iPhone 6 and the problem was still there. Have contacted apple and this has been escalated to Tier 3 engineers. Waiting for a response (should be today) but I suspect it's a hardware issue that is going to require a replacement (and a 100 miles round trip to an apple store as I don't have a CC)
